Customs thwarted on Saturday an attempt by a Lebanese national to smuggle 7 kilograms of gold into Syria at the northern border town of al-Arida, the National News Agency reported.
According to NNA the car hold a Lebanese license plate.
Meanwhile, Syria’s State news agency SANA said that the customs confiscated a large quantity of advanced quantity devices, cigarettes, fabrics and electric heaters aboard a Pullman bus that has a license plate from Idlib and heading to Aleppo.
The news agency reported that the bus driver is a Syrian national.
The incident also took place at al-Arida border.
The poorly-demarcated Syrian-Lebanese border has witnessed a number of arms smuggling operations and violations since the revolt against Syrian President Bashar Assad began in mid-March 2011.
